Memorial Day Weekend, 2008.
We needed to finish a short fence along the upper wall beside the driveway in order to comply with the occupancy terms from the county. Dennis and Kathy were joined by Matt and Greg, and we all spent our first night at the lakehouse (illegally!) We arrived very late Friday night and, putting aside any plans to enjoy each other's company to "celebrate" with games and/or movies, we just fell into the beds and slept!
Dennis and Kathy were up early Saturday...absolutely beautiful day...it was so quiet and peaceful..and headed off to purchase the necessary materials to build the fence and buy some food at the local WalMart. Had a light breakfast with M and G and began to work. Quickly learned that it would be much harder to build than anticipated, as the 11' foot rails had to be cut to fit the 8' distance between the line posts, with the ends cut in 3 dimensions to fit together properly. Eventually, Dennis headed back out to buy a tablesaw, and M and G went downstairs to assemble and mount the bigscreen TV in the Media Room.
Dennis returned with the materials, we had a quicklunch, applauded the working TV (DVDs only at this point) and then "people" began to arrive. First, some friends (California/Gaithersburg/Deep Creek) came by to tour the house; they later returned on their gorgeous speedboat to tempt us to go out on the water for awhile (we regretfully declined). Then the landscaper arrived to walk the property and discuss plans for terracing, shrubbery, grading, etc. Then the builder arrived to do a final walkthrough with us on the house.
As the sun began to set it became clear that we would not finish on Saturday as originally planned. M and G agreed to stay another night. Kathy headed out to pick up take-out dinner (18 miles away!) and after dinner we played Hearts in the Dining Room...so dark, so quiet outside!
Sunday morning the men resumed work on the fence, while Kathy packed away boxes that were stacking up in the garage (Christmas stuff and decor items), tested the sealant on the foyer slate and stained the handrails on the staircases. The fence was finished shortly after noon, we cleaned up ourselves and the house, broke down boxes, took additional measurement, etc., before leaving slightly before 2 p.m. Arrived back in Derwood at just before 5 pm, M and G took off (previous plans for Sat nite), we made it to Mass, then headed up to Fred and Nancylee's to join the rest of the family for relaxing dinner.
How wonderful it was up there! How hard it was to leave!
